The Well Center
The Well Center, located at 204 East Main Street in Pendleton, South Carolina, is a health institution specializing in therapy for adults, couples, teens, and children. If you are experiencing anxiety, sadness, or feeling stuck in patterns that are no longer serving you, The Well Center is here to help. With locations in Clemson and Greenville, South Carolina, our team of therapists offers specialized care using evidence-based techniques such as CBT, mindfulness, narrative therapy, and creative arts. We provide services for a wide range of issues including an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, trauma, and major life stress. Our therapists have diverse specializations including ADHD, trauma, LGBTQIA support, couples counseling, and more. We offer individual and family counseling for teens and adults, and work with children as young as 5 years old.
